服务器硬盘送人前如何清理?

alf*_*ish 6 security

我打算向一个随机的人出售一台 Linux 服务器。出于显而易见的原因,我想清理硬盘,以便永远无法检索磁盘上的当前数据。这样做最安全的方法是什么?操作系统重装?rm -rf *? 或者是其他东西?

服务器位于同一位置,我没有物理访问权限。

EEA*_*EAA 19

DBAN

或者,如果您想要更简单的东西(但理论上不太安全),请启动 livecd 并执行以下操作:

$ dd if=/dev/zero of=/dev/sdX
Run Code Online (Sandbox Code Playgroud)

  • `rm -rf` 不会将驱动器清零,它只会清除指向驱动器上数据所在位置的文件系统表条目。数据恢复实用程序仍然能够在`rm -rf` 之后恢复数据。 (3认同)

Cha*_*ler 9

shred -z /dev/sdX
Run Code Online (Sandbox Code Playgroud)

这将用随机数据覆盖硬盘 3 次,并在最后的第四遍将零写入磁盘。您可以使用该-n选项调整传递次数。 man shred更多选择。